What Is Symlin?

Symlin (pramlintide) is an FDA-approved amylin analog used with mealtime insulin in type 1 and type 2 diabetes. It can help blunt post-meal glucose excursions, but it also carries a boxed warning for severe hypoglycemia when combined with insulin.
